package build
import (
"bytes"
"fmt"
"io"
"log"
"github.com/docker/buildx/build"
"github.com/docker/buildx/util/progress"
"github.com/docker/docker/api/types/versions"
"github.com/moby/buildkit/client"
"github.com/moby/buildkit/frontend/subrequests"
"github.com/moby/buildkit/frontend/subrequests/outline"
"github.com/moby/buildkit/frontend/subrequests/targets"
"github.com/moby/buildkit/solver/errdefs"
"github.com/morikuni/aec"
"github.com/sirupsen/logrus"
)
// PrintResult writes the result information to the specified writer.
func PrintResult(w io.Writer, f *build.PrintFunc, res map[string]string) error {
switch f.Name {
case "outline":
return printValue(outline.PrintOutline, outline.SubrequestsOutlineDefinition.Version, f.Format, res, w)
case "targets":
return printValue(targets.PrintTargets, targets.SubrequestsTargetsDefinition.Version, f.Format, res, w)
case "subrequests.describe":
return printValue(subrequests.PrintDescribe, subrequests.SubrequestsDescribeDefinition.Version, f.Format, res, w)
default:
if dt, ok := res["result.txt"]; ok {
fmt.Fprint(w, dt)
} else {
log.Printf("%s %+v", f, res)
}
}
return nil
}
type printFunc func([]byte, io.Writer) error
func printValue(printer printFunc, version string, format string, res map[string]string, w io.Writer) error {
if format == "json" {
fmt.Fprintln(w, res["result.json"])
return nil
}
if res["version"] != "" && versions.LessThan(version, res["version"]) && res["result.txt"] != "" {
// structure is too new and we don't know how to print it
fmt.Fprint(w, res["result.txt"])
return nil
}
return printer([]byte(res["result.json"]), w)
}
// PrintWarnings writes the warning information to the specified writer.
func PrintWarnings(w io.Writer, warnings []client.VertexWarning, mode string) {
if len(warnings) == 0 || mode == progress.PrinterModeQuiet {
return
}
fmt.Fprintf(w, "\n ")
sb := &bytes.Buffer{}
if len(warnings) == 1 {
fmt.Fprintf(sb, "1 warning found")
} else {
fmt.Fprintf(sb, "%d warnings found", len(warnings))
}
if logrus.GetLevel() < logrus.DebugLevel {
fmt.Fprintf(sb, " (use --debug to expand)")
}
fmt.Fprintf(sb, ":\n")
fmt.Fprint(w, aec.Apply(sb.String(), aec.YellowF))
for _, warn := range warnings {
fmt.Fprintf(w, " - %s\n", warn.Short)
if logrus.GetLevel() < logrus.DebugLevel {
continue
}
for _, d := range warn.Detail {
fmt.Fprintf(w, "%s\n", d)
}
if warn.URL != "" {
fmt.Fprintf(w, "More info: %s\n", warn.URL)
}
if warn.SourceInfo != nil && warn.Range != nil {
src := errdefs.Source{
Info: warn.SourceInfo,
Ranges: warn.Range,
}
src.Print(w)
}
fmt.Fprintf(w, "\n")
}
}
